Paurotis Palm and Bismarck Palm Genus and Other Classification
While comparing scientific classification, Paurotis Palm and Bismarck Palm genus and other classification are also important. Also, when you compare Paurotis Palm and Bismarck Palm, other factors should also be taken into considerations like order, subfamilies, tribe, clade etc. First plant's genus is Acoelorrhaphe and other plant's genus is Bismarckia. Paurotis Palm tribe is Corypheae and Bismarck Palm tribe is Borasseae. Paurotis Palm clade is Angiosperms, Commelinids and Monocots and order is Arecales whereas Bismarck Palm clade is Angiosperms, Commelinids and Monocots and order is Arecales. Every plant have subfamilies. Paurotis Palm subfamilies are, Coryphoideae and Bismarck Palm subfamilies are Coryphoideae.
